Benefits Of Using Fastags While Travelling In India

It may be annoying for anybody to wait in long lines at highway booths to pay tolls. The FASTag system, an electronic toll collection system that uses stickers on car windscreens, was brought into effect by the National Highways Authority of India (NHAI) to address this issue. Toll costs are automatically withdrawn from the prepaid wallet balances on these FASTag stickers as the vehicle passes through the toll booth. The Indian government has mandated the use of this cashless technology for all four-wheelers. How Does A Fastag Work?
FASTag operates using Radio Frequency Identification (RFID) technology and is linked to a prepaid account, enabling automatic toll payments. You may recharge these prepaid tags and place them on your car's windscreen. FASTag makes travelling on the highway easier because you don't have to stop at toll booths or wait impatiently for your turn. In order to get a FASTag, you must first recharge the FASTag account, give vehicle and owner information, and register with a partner bank or online payment platform. The FASTag may be connected to a bank account or prepaid wallet to enable automatic top-ups. You may use mobile applications or web interfaces to check your transaction history, recharge the FASTag, and keep an eye on your account balance.
Benefits Of Using Fastag In India
Let's explore the advantages of FASTag for Indian drivers.
Cashless Convenience
FASTag's eliminates the need of using cash at toll booths. One of the main causes of toll booth traffic congestion is cash transactions. Driving through toll plazas without having to fumble for change while making payments is now a hassle-free experience for drivers.
Time And Fuel Efficiency
You may save fuel and time by using FASTag. The toll money is withdrawn from the bank account linked with your FASTag or your FASTag's prepaid wallet once your FASTag is scanned and read by the tag reader at toll plazas. You can save time by avoiding queues and passing through toll plazas without halting at all. Additionally, you may avoid wasting fuel while standing in lengthy queues to pay the toll.
SMS Alerts And Transparency
The toll cost is deducted from your account or prepaid wallet each time you cross a toll plaza. Both an email and an SMS alert are sent to your registered phone number and email address to notify you of the deduction. You may use this to monitor how much you have spent on toll plazas. Additionally, the FASTag site allows you to view your FASTag statements.
Environmental Benefits
FASTag has made a substantial contribution to reducing the amount of time that vehicles stay idle at toll plazas, which has decreased vehicle emissions. Fuel consumption decreases with less time spent idle, which in turn reduces carbon dioxide (CO2) emissions. This emission decrease supports ecological preservation efforts and works in tandem with sustainable travel policies. Additionally, drivers save money due to reduced fuel use, which makes FASTag a practical and sustainable option. It encourages more efficient traffic movement, reduces needless fuel consumption, and helps India's environment become cleaner. Additionally, this technology helps us fulfil our overarching sustainability goals by enhancing the quality of the highway for all users.
Nationwide Usability
FASTag has been installed all throughout the country and is accepted at all toll booths on state and federal highways as well as certain city roads. It guarantees smooth travel for cars with FASTag, no matter where they are in India.
Online Recharge
FASTag's online recharge option adds even more convenience to utilising it. Debit cards, credit cards, RTGS transfers, NEFT transfers, and even internet banking may all be used to recharge your FASTag online. All you require is access to the internet.
Five Years Validity Period
A FASTag has a lengthy validity duration of five years. During this period, you can benefit from cashless toll payments instead of continuously purchasing new tolls. Make sure your bank account is operational or that you have sufficient funds in your NHAI wallet.

Toll Operators’ Benefits
Toll operators can save operational expenses by using the FASTag system since it eliminates the need to pay workers to collect toll fees manually. FASTags guarantee improved audit control by centralising user accounts, which eliminates the possibility of toll fee leaks. FASTag installation guarantees faster traffic flow on highways. This increases the current highway network's capacity in an indirect manner without constructing any new infrastructure.
Fastag Ownership When Buying a Used Cars
When buying a second-hand car in Kerala, checking the status of the FASTag is essential. FASTag is a mandatory electronic toll collection system that links to the vehicle’s registration number and a prepaid account. Before completing the purchase, ensure that the FASTag linked to the vehicle has been deactivated or transferred properly by the previous owner. If not, the new owner might face issues such as toll charges being deducted from the former owner's account or complications during recharging. To avoid such hassles, it's recommended to either get a new FASTag in your name or update the ownership details through the respective bank or FASTag issuer.
